Our Mission
In Malaysia, teenagers experience stress, anxiety and depression more than ever before. One in every five teenagers between 13-17 years old had experienced depression*. We strive to increase teenagers' knowledge, skills and competencies at improving their own mental wellbeing.
Our mission is to produce 1 million happy and confident teenagers in Malaysia. We do this through coaching, counselling and positive psychology education directly for teenagers. Apart from that, we also empower, educate and enable parents, teachers, and mental health practitioners to generate a stronger force towards our mission.
